On 03/11/13 10:09, Mike Solomon wrote:
Looks like some files in flower don't play nice with the most recent version of the standard library bundled with Xcode… Any ideas for how to proceed?
If I understand right (I'm not a Mac user), latest Xcode has clang as default compiler, and symlinks the gcc/g++ commands to clang/clang++. So, these errors most likely arise because Lilypond compilation has never been tested with clang (apologies if I'm wrong, but I imagine Lilypond development has always assumed GCC).
